btc爆破私钥 btc密钥破解

发布时间:2025-11-22 09:56:01 浏览:14 分类:比特币资讯
大小:509.7 MB 版本:v6.141.0
欧易官网正版APP,返佣推荐码:61662149

一、破解BTC的私钥到底有多难

破解BTC的私钥极其困难。

BTC(比特币)的核心是采用ECDSA(椭圆曲线数字签名算法)进行加密,该算法采用secp256k1椭圆曲线。最终BTC的私钥是一个256bit的数字,每个私钥对应一个公钥。转化为十进制数,私钥的取值范围是从1到约115792089237316195423570985008687907852837564279074904382605163141518161494336(这个数字大约是2^256范围内最大的质数,与2^256相差并不大)。

破解BTC私钥的难度主要体现在以下几个方面:

私钥空间巨大:

私钥是一个256位的数字,其取值范围极其庞大,几乎是一个无法想象的天文数字。这意味着要找到一个特定的私钥,需要在如此巨大的数字空间中进行搜索,其难度可想而知。

暴力搜索的不可行性:

破解私钥的一种方法是进行暴力搜索,即在整个私钥范围内逐一尝试。然而,由于私钥空间巨大,即使使用最先进的计算机和算法,也需要极长的时间才能完成搜索。实际上,这种方法的可行性几乎为零。

私钥碰撞的极低概率:

另一种可能的方法是找到两个私钥,它们产生相同的公钥(即私钥碰撞)。然而,在如此巨大的私钥空间中,找到两个这样的私钥的概率极低,几乎可以忽略不计。

实际操作的复杂性:

除了上述数学上的难度外,实际操作中还面临着诸多挑战。例如,需要处理大量的数据和计算资源,以及确保搜索过程的准确性和可靠性。这些都增加了破解私钥的难度。

具体数据说明:

如果尝试通过暴力搜索来破解私钥,即使每次查询只需要1微秒(10^-6秒),遍历整个私钥空间也需要约10^71次方秒的时间。这是一个无法想象的时间长度,远远超出了人类和现有技术的能力范围。地球上的沙子数量约为10^22粒,即使每次选择一粒沙子并假设它能变成一个地球(这是一个极端的假设),然后在这个新的地球上再选择一粒沙子,并重复这个过程三次(即10^(22+22+22)次),再在这个结果中选择1千亿粒沙子中的一粒(即10^11次),这样的概率仍然远远低于找到一个有余额的BTC私钥的概率。

结论:

综上所述,破解BTC的私钥是一项极其困难的任务。由于私钥空间巨大、暴力搜索的不可行性、私钥碰撞的极低概率以及实际操作的复杂性等因素的综合作用,使得破解私钥成为一项几乎不可能完成的任务。因此,BTC的安全性得到了极大的保障。

二、btc私钥格式

BTC私钥主要有原始格式、Hex格式、WIF格式和WIF-compressed格式这几种,具体介绍如下:

原始格式:BTC私钥的原始格式是32字节,也就是256位的0或者1。这是私钥最基础、最原始的表示形式,从本质上来说,它是一串由0和1组成的二进制数据,在比特币系统中,这串数据是生成公钥和地址等关键信息的核心依据。不过,由于其直接以二进制形式呈现,不便于人们直接查看、记录和传输,所以在实际应用中,通常会将其转换为其他更易处理的格式。

Hex格式:Hex格式即十六进制格式,它是对原始二进制私钥的一种更直观的表示方式。Hex格式又分为压缩和非压缩两种情况。压缩格式是在非压缩格式的基础上加上01得到的。需要注意的是,hex非压缩格式私钥只能转换成WIF格式私钥,而hex压缩格式私钥只能转换成WIF-compressed格式私钥。这种格式的转换使得私钥的表示更加简洁,也方便在不同系统和软件之间进行数据交换。

WIF(wallet-import-format)格式:WIF格式的私钥以5开头。这种格式是为了方便用户导入和导出私钥而设计的,它将原始的私钥数据经过一系列的编码和转换,形成了一种更易于识别和使用的格式。用户在使用比特币钱包时,如果需要将私钥从一个钱包导入到另一个钱包,WIF格式的私钥就提供了很大的便利。

WIF-compressed(WIF压缩格式):WIF-compressed格式的私钥以K或者L开头。与WIF格式类似,它也是为了方便私钥的导入和导出,但针对的是压缩后的私钥数据。这种格式在保证私钥安全性的同时,进一步减少了私钥的存储空间和传输数据量,提高了数据处理的效率。